REASONS CHILDREN MAY REQUIRE speech pathologY

Here are some of the most common reasons children visit our clinic along with how we support each area of concern.

LANGUAGE DEVELOPMENT
Support the development of language skills that enable children to understand others and express themselves clearly and confidently.

SPEECH SOUNDS
Support clear and accurate pronunciation to be better understood by others.

SOCIAL COMMUNICATION
Help develop conversation skills, turn-taking and understand social cues.

NON-VERBAL/MINIMAL VERBAL COMMUNICATION
Support communication through alternative methods such as visuals, gestures or communication devices.

FLUENCY (STUTTERING)

Build smoother and more confident speech when talking.

VOICE
Support healthy voice use and and help improve voice quality for every day communication.

COMMON CONCERN

“My child isn’t talking yet”

At Speech Mark, we understand how concerning this can feel as parents/caregivers. Children develop communication at different rates. While some variation is normal, delays beyond expected ages may mean a child could benefit from support.

How speech therapy supports young children

At Speech Mark, therapy is play-based, engaging, and embedded in everyday interactions. Support may help children:

  • Understand and use sounds, words, gestures, and early language

  • Communicate wants, needs, thoughts, and feelings more effectively

  • Reduce frustration by strengthening functional communication

  • Build foundations for learning, social interaction, and participation

Early support, without pressure

Early support is not about rushing milestones, it’s about meeting children where they are and supporting communication at the right time. Our approach is evidence-based allowing children to progress in their own way with clear guidance for families.
